发明名称 HYBRID SUPERCHARGED ENGINE
摘要 PROBLEM TO BE SOLVED: To reduce the turbo lug and to improve the starting characteristics by installing a turbo charger which has the maximum capacity at a speed higher than the maximum torque rotating speed of an engine, and a positive displacement supercharger in seried, and performing the two-stage supercharging, while controlling the positive displacement supercharger to constantly keep the air supply amount. SOLUTION: A hybrid supercharged engine comprises a SC (positive displacement supercharger) 5 which is driven by the power of an engine through a belt 4, and further comprises a TC(turbo charger) 10 including a turbine 10b using the exhaust of the engine 1 as a power source, and a compressor 10a of the TC 16 is installed at a downstream side of SC 5. The intake air of which the pressure is risen by these supercharging means, is supplied to the engine 1 through a feed pipe 13 and an air cooler 12. The TC 10 is tuned to obtain a point (d) as the maximum capacity of the TC 10 at the maximum speed of the engine 1. Further on the SC 5, a bypass valve 20 is controlled through an actuator 18 by an electronic controller 17, so that the air intake amount becomes constant regardless of the speed of the engine.
